Galette Bretonne

The Galette Bretonne, or Breton pancake, is one of the most iconic dishes from Brittany. Made with buckwheat flour, it has a savory and nutty flavor. It’s usually served with ham and cheese, or other fillings such as smoked salmon or egg.

Far Breton

Far Breton is a traditional dessert made with eggs, milk, flour and prunes. While it looks like a cake, it’s actually more similar to a custard pudding due to its soft texture. Far Breton is often served with cream or ice cream for an extra indulgent treat.
